Electric Car Innovations Set to Dominate in the Coming Years

Battery Tech: More Miles, Less Charge Time Electric vehicle batteries are finally catching up with consumer expectations and then some. Solid state batteries, long hyped and slow moving, are now edging closer to real world production. These packs ditch the flammable liquids, which means better safety, higher energy density, and simply more miles per charge. […]
